As the title says, Stonesense consistently hangs when designating a construction on the bottommost layer of hell. Other layers are unaffected. I suspect the issue is caused by some function only accounting for layers at or above z level 1, with the bottom of hell being z level 0. Stonesense renders the lowest level of hell just fine when you're not trying to build on it, and there is no hang if stonesense is loaded after the construction is finished, suggesting that the issue lies in the code to create the designation outlines.
